Mike Alco has been tattooing professionally since 2016, but his connection to art started long before that. From a young age, he was constantly drawing, painting, and sculpting, always finding ways to create and express himself through art.
In 2015, Mike made a major life change by leaving his career as a broker to pursue art full-time in Colombia. During that time, he focused on painting murals and participating in art shows, eventually realizing that tattooing was the medium that brought together everything he loved most about art. In 2016, he moved back to New Jersey and fully committed to tattooing professionally.
The following years played a huge role in shaping him as both an artist and a person. Mike worked in a variety of street shops, learning how to adapt, work hard, and take on a wide range of tattoo styles and projects. While constantly moving between different environments wasn’t always easy, it helped him grow quickly and build a strong foundation within the industry. Over time, he also found a sense of community through tattoo conventions, connecting with artists who shared the same passion and standards for the craft.
That journey eventually led him to Soul Kraft Ink in 2021, where he has proudly worked ever since. Being surrounded by a supportive and talented team has allowed him to continue refining his craft while creating the experience his clients deserve.
Mike specializes in black and grey realism, American traditional, and freehand floral work, though his background in street shops keeps him open to exploring a wide variety of styles. He enjoys collaborating closely with clients to create tattoos that feel personal, intentional, and built to last.
